New Recycling Pick-up in Barnwell

Along with the changes to garbage pick-up, we are also changing the pick-up day for recycling as well. You will see the recycle trucks out in the village every Friday but they will be picking up half the village each week. 

Starting on September 3rd, 2021 pick up will be done on the south side of the village with the old highway being the dividing line. The north side of the village will be picked up on September 10th, 2021 and this will continue alternating each week. 

You will find the map for recycling below. You will also receive a calendar indicating which half of the village will have recycle pick-up on which week.

New Garbage Cart System in Barnwell

We are changing things for weekly garbage pick-up! By the end of August or first few days of September, all Barnwell residents will be receiving a garbage cart that belongs with the property. This is what you will use to roll out your garbage to the curb for pick-up.

Pick-up will be every Friday, roll your cart out in the morning and roll it back in the afternoon. If a holiday lands on Friday, garbage pick up will be the next business day.

These bins are for household garbage only!

Do not put any of the following items in your cart: construction/demolition materials, household hazardous wastes, animal carcasses or any other harmful or hazardous items.

Barnwell Days Tournaments – July 16th & 17th

Pickleball Tournament – Teams are doubles, of any combination of men and women ages 14 and up. First 16 teams to sign up will get to play. Round Robin games will start Friday evening and playoffs will be on Saturday. Please indicate skill level when signing up, beginner, intermediate or good. Email Jeremy Cooper to sign up, registration will continue until all spots are filled or until Monday, July 12th, which ever is sooner. [email protected]

Volleyball Tournament – We are looking for 8 teams of a minimum of 6 people, more if you want any subs, at least 2 women need to be on the court all the time. Games will be played at Willow Park just West of the Pickleball Courts starting Friday evening and continuing Saturday after breakfast. Contact Kyle Bullock @ 403-894-4649 or email [email protected] for questions and to register.

Crib Tournament – Teams of two must be registered by Monday July 12th. Games will be played at Willow Park Place (the old library). You can contact Sheldon Hoyt at 403-332-3574 with any questions and to register.

Village of Barnwell New Animal Bylaw

At the February 18th meeting of Village Council, the new Animal Bylaw was passed with the third reading. Council has put in place a 90 day education period before any part of the new bylaw will be enforced by our bylaw officers.

The new bylaw will then be enforced as of May 19, 2021.

Taber / Vauxhall RCMP Detachment Community Consultation 

Sergeant Gord Yetman of the Taber/Vauxhall RCMP Detachment wants to hear from local community members in the Taber/Vauxhall RCMP detachment area, who may have any comments and/or concerns about policing issues in the following geographic areas: 

  • Municipal District of Taber (general), 
  • Hamlet of Grassy Lake, 
  • Hamlet of Hays, 
  • Hamlet of Enchant, 
  • Hamlet of Wrentham, 
  • Town of Vauxhall and 
  • Village of Barnwell 

This information is being collected to assist Sgt. Yetman in determining the top priorities for Taber/Vauxhall Detachment’s upcoming Annual Performance Plan. The Annual Performance Plan is a document that aligns community priorities with the operations of the detachment over the coming year. This year’s plan will be based largely on input from our communities as to priorities they would like to see their RCMP Detachment focus on. 

Normally, a Town Hall meeting would have been scheduled to hear any comments, questions or concerns, but due to the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ic, Sgt. Yetman is accepting input from community members through email.
